#f5b8e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5b8e9 is composed of 96.1% red, 72.2%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.9% magenta, 4.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 311.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 84.1%. #f5b8e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b71d3.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

#f5b8e9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f5b8e9 has RGB values of R:245, G:184,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.05,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16103657.

Hex triplet f5b8e9 #f5b8e9
RGB Decimal 245, 184, 233 rgb(245,184,233)
RGB Percent 96.1, 72.2, 91.4 rgb(96.1%,72.2%,91.4%)
CMYK 0, 25, 5, 4
HSL 311.8°, 75.3, 84.1 hsl(311.8,75.3%,84.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 311.8°, 24.9, 96.1
Web Safe ffccff #ffccff
CIE-LAB 81.609, 29.735, -15.81
XYZ 69.503, 59.579, 84.925
xyY 0.325, 0.278, 59.579
CIE-LCH 81.609, 33.677, 332.001
CIE-LUV 81.609, 32.274, -29.796
Hunter-Lab 77.187, 25.652, -11.203
Binary 11110101, 10111000, 11101001

Shades and Tints of #f5b8e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f020c is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.
